هاست دانلود چیست؟

به زبون ساده، هاست دانلود همون فضاییه که فایل‌هاتو توش می‌ذاری تا بقیه بتونن راحت و سریع دانلودش کنن. بعضیا بهش می‌گن «هاست فایل» هم، چون کل هدفش ذخیره و ارائه فایل‌هاست؛ مثلاً ویدیو، موزیک، نرم‌افزار یا هر چیزی که کاربر بخواد مستقیم بگیره.

فرقش با هاست معمولی اینه که تمرکزش روی این نیست که سایت رو نمایش بده یا قالب و اسکریپت سایتت رو نگه‌داره؛ نه، کارش فقط تحویل فایل‌ها به کاربراست.

اگه تو هم محتوای زیادی داری و می‌خوای سریع و بدون فشار روی هاست اصلی‌ت، برسه دست کاربرات، تا حالا به خرید هاست دانلود فکر کردی؟

در عمل، یک سرور هاست دانلود:

فضای ذخیره‌سازی کافی و پهنای باند زیاد دارد تا بتواند فایل‌های بزرگ را سریع انتقال دهد.

معمولاً از بار اجرای کدهای سمت سرور (مثل PHP، پردازش دیتابیس زیاد و منطق پیچیده) پشتیبانی نمی‌کند یا اگر پشتیبانی کند، خیلی محدود است.

بهینه‌سازی‌های خاصی برای ارسال فایل (مثلاً بخش‌بندی دانلود، resume کردن دانلود، مدیریت استریم) دارد.

گاهی اوقات ترکیبی از CDN (شبکه توزیع ) است تا کاربران از نزدیک‌ترین نقطه شبکه بتوانند دانلود کنند و سرعت بالاتر شود.

هاست دانلود چیست

تفاوت هاست دانلود با هاست معمولی

در مقایسه با هاست لینوکس عادی، جایی که منابع باید بین اجرای وب‌سایت، دیتابیس، کش، و ارسال تصاویر تقسیم شوند، هاست دانلود اختصاصی برای فایل‌های دانلودی طراحی شده است. به قول یکی از شرکت‌ها: «هاست دانلود یک راه‌حل مکمل یا مستقل برای پروژه‌هایی است که حجم فایل‌ها بالا است و نمی‌خواهیم منابع اصلی سایت تحت فشار قرار گیرد.

گاهی هم از اصطلاح «میزبانی فایل» (File Hosting) استفاده می‌شود که معادل یا بسیار نزدیک به مفهوم هاست دانلود است. IONOS+1

نیازهای ما به هاست دانلود

چرا به هاست دانلود نیاز داریم؟

در پروژه‌هایی که فایل‌های قابل دانلود زیاد دارند — کتاب‌های الکترونیکی، پادکست‌ها، بسته‌های نرم‌افزاری، دوره‌های ویدیویی، افزونه‌ها و غیره — استفاده از هاست وب معمولی اغلب باعث مشکلات زیر می‌شود:

  • افزایش بار سرور اصلی و کند شدن وب‌سایت
    وقتی تعداد کاربران زیاد است یا فایل‌ها بزرگ‌اند، دانلودها بخش عمده منابع پردازنده، دیسک و پهنای باند را می‌بلعند و باعث می‌شوند وقتی کاربران به صفحات سایت مراجعه می‌کنند، سرعت آن پایین بیاید.
  • هزینه زیاد ارتقاء‌هاست وب یا سرور

    اگر بخواهید هاست وبتان را دائماً ارتقاء دهید تا بتواند ترافیک دانلود زیاد را تحمل کند، هزینه‌ها ممکن است بسیار بالا رود؛ در مقابل، یک هاست دانلود به‌صرفه‌تر است در بسیاری از موارد.
  • کنترل بهتر بر روی دانلودها

    امکاناتی مثل محدود کردن سرعت دانلود، قابلیت ادامه دانلود (resume)، شمارش دانلودها، مدیریت لینک مستقیم و غیرمستقیم — در هاست دانلود بهتر پیاده می‌شوند.
  • کاهش تأثیر جغرافیایی و بهبود سرعت برای کاربران دور

    با استفاده از CDN همراه با هاست دانلود، کاربران در نقاط دورتر هم سرعت دانلود مناسبی خواهند داشت.
  • تقسیم بار بین فایل و محتواهای سایت

    شما می‌توانید فایل‌های دانلودی را از دامنه یا زیر دامنه‌ای جدا بارگذاری کنید، تا سایت اصلی‌تان سبک‌تر و بهتر پاسخ دهد.

معایب و محدودیت‌ها (تهدیدها)

نمی‌خواهم صرفاً جنبه مثبت بگویم — واقعیت این است که بعضی مواقع هاست دانلود مناسب نیست یا باید با دقت انتخاب شود:

  • عدم پشتیبانی از پردازش سمت سرور (Scripts)

    اگر فایل دانلودی همراه با کدهایی باشد که باید پردازش شوند (مثلاً تولید لینک، شمارنده، یا تایید اعتبار کاربر در لحظه دانلود)، برخی هاست‌های دانلود ممکن است محدود باشند.
  • امنیت و دسترسی فایل‌ها

    اگر فایل‌ها رایگان نیستند یا حق دانلود دارند، مهم است که دسترسی غیرمجاز کنترل شود (مثلاً لینک مستقیم نشود، یا کاربر حتماً لاگین باشد). این مسائل را باید خودتان یا ارائه‌دهنده مدیریت کند.
  • هزینه برای پهنای باند بزرگ

    اگر حجم دانلودها بالا باشد، هزینه پهنای باند ممکن است زیاد شود. حتی اگر هاست دانلود به ظاهر ارزان باشد، وقتی تعداد دانلود بالا رود، هزینه‌ها بر می‌گردد.
  • وابستگی به زیرساخت ارائه‌دهنده

    اگر شرکت ارائه‌دهنده مشکل فنی داشته باشد، فایل‌ها برای کاربران در دسترس نخواهند بود.

کاربردها و مثال‌ها

بیاید با مثال‌ها صحبت کنیم، چون همیشه تحلیل با مثال ملموس بهتر جا می‌افتد:

  • یک مدرس آنلاین که دوره‌های ویدئویی ضبط‌شده می‌فروشد، نیاز دارد کاربر بتواند ویدیوها را دانلود یا استریم کند. اگر این مدرس دوره‌ها را روی همان هاست وب سایت خودش قرار دهد، ممکن است سایت با مشکل روبرو شود. استفاده از هاست دانلود برای ذخیره و عرضه ویدیوها معمول است.
  • یک شرکت نرم‌افزاری که نسخه نصبی برنامک را به مشتریان ارائه می‌دهد، نیاز دارد دانلود با سرعت بالا و مطمئن انجام شود.
  • سایت‌هایی که آرشیو داده یا دیتاست (مثلاً برای پژوهشگران) منتشر می‌کنند، معمولاً از هاست دانلود یا خدمات ذخیره‌سازی مخصوص استفاده می‌کنند.
  • در سایت‌های اشتراک پرونده (مثل اشتراک عکس، اسناد یا فایل‌های مشترک) هم این نوع میزبانی کاربرد دارد.

وضعیت بازار و آمارها

برای اینکه بدانیم چقدر بازار میزبانی وب و زیرشاخه‌های آن بزرگ است و رشد می‌کند، نگاهی به آمارها بیندازیم:

  • بازار خدمات میزبانی وب در سال ۲۰۲۳ ارزشی حدود ۱۱۱.۸ میلیارد دلار برآورد شده و پیش‌بینی می‌شود بین سال‌های ۲۰۲۴ تا ۲۰۳۲ با نرخ مرکب سالانه (CAGR) حدود ۱۸.۵٪ رشد کند. Global Market Insights Inc.
  • در گزارش دیگری، بازار خدمات میزبانی وب در سال ۲۰۲۲ حدود ۷۷.۷۸ میلیارد دلار ارزش داشت و تا سال ۲۰۳۰ پیش‌بینی شده است به ۳۲۰.۶۲ میلیارد دلار برسد. Grand View Research
  • یکی از تحلیل‌های به‌روز می‌گوید رشد صنعت میزبانی وب تقریباً ۱۹.۷٪ است، رقمی که هم‌پای رشد بخش‌هایی مثل تجارت الکترونیک به شمار می‌آید. HostingAdvice.com

البته این‌ها آمار کلی برای میزبانی وب وردپرس هستند، نه دقیقاً هاست دانلود. ولی از آنجا که دانلود فایل یکی از وزن‌دارترین قسمت‌های کارکرد وب است، رشد بازار عمومی میزبانی بر فرصت و اهمیت هاست دانلود هم تأثیر می‌گذارد.

نکات مهم هنگام انتخاب هاست دانلود

حالا که مفهوم و اهمیت را روشن کردیم، بیایید به بخش عملی برسیم — اگر شما بخواهید هاست دانلود بخرید یا استفاده کنید، باید به چه ویژگی‌هایی توجه کنید:

  1. پهنای باند (Bandwidth)

    مقدار داده‌ای که می‌خواهید در طول ماه منتقل شود را برآورد کنید. اگر چند ترابایت یا ده‌ها ترابایت باشد، هاستی بخرید که محدودیت پایین نداشته باشد.
  2. فضای ذخیره‌سازی (Storage)

    اگر فایل‌هایتان بزرگ‌اند (ویدیو، نرم‌افزار، دیتاست)، مطمئن شوید هاست فضا و سرعت خوبی دارد (ترجیحاً SSD).
  3. امکانات دانلود پیشرفته

    ویژگی‌هایی مثل resume دانلود (ادامه دانلود از نقطه قطع‌شده)، محدودیت سرعت (باندل کردن دانلود‌ها)، و لینک‌های یک‌بار مصرف یا توکن شده، بسیار مهم‌اند.
  4. پشتیبانی CDN یا توزیع جغرافیایی

    اگر کاربرانی از نقاط مختلف دنیا دارید، وجود CDN (شبکه توزیع محتوا) کمک می‌کند تا دانلود سریع‌تر انجام شود.
  5. امنیت و کنترل دسترسی

    اگر فایل‌ها پولی هستند یا حق دسترسی دارند، باید مکانیزم‌هایی مثل تأیید هویت، لینک‌های رمزنگاری شده یا اعتبارسنجی وجود داشته باشد.
  6. پایداری و SLA (Service Level Agreement)

    اطمینان از زمان بالا بودن سرویس (uptime) و تضمین از جانب ارائه‌دهنده (مثلاً ۹۹.۹٪) مهم است.
  7. قیمت و هزینه پهنای باند مازاد

    بعضی برنامه‌ها ممکن است محدوده پایه داشته باشند و اگر بیشتر دانلود شود، هزینه اضافی اعمال شود.
  8. انعطاف‌پذیری و مقیاس‌پذیری

    امکان ارتقاء به پلن بزرگ‌تر در آینده بدون دردسر مهم است، چون ممکن است حجم دانلودها رو به افزایش باشد.

تفاوت هاست دانلود و پربازدید

تفاوت هاست دانلود و پربازدید در اولویت‌بندی منابع است: یکی برای “جابجایی اطلاعات زیاد” و دیگری برای “پردازش درخواست‌های زیاد” بهینه‌سازی شده است. با توجه به ماهیت وب‌سایت خود، می‌توانید بهترین تصمیم را بگیرید. برای تضمین عملکرد وب‌سایت و پایداری در هر شرایطی، ترکیب این دو سرویس، یعنی استفاده از یک هاست پربازدید برای محتوای اصلی و یک هاست دانلود برای فایل‌ها، بهترین استراتژی را در اختیار شما قرار می‌دهد.

ویژگیهاست دانلود (Download Host)هاست پربازدید (High Traffic Host)
هدف اصلیتوزیع فایل‌های حجیم و زیادنمایش سریع محتوا به بازدیدکنندگان زیاد
اولویت منابعپهنای باند و فضای دیسکقدرت پردازشی (CPU/RAM) و سرعت I/O
نوع ذخیره‌سازیمعمولاً HDD یا SSD معمولی (برای حجم بالا)حتماً SSD یا NVMe (برای سرعت بالا)
نصب CMS (مثل وردپرس)معمولاً توصیه نمی‌شودمناسب است (هدف اصلی)
مصرف ترافیکبسیار زیاد و مورد انتظارزیاد تا متوسط
قیمتمعمولاً بر اساس پهنای باند و حجم دیسکمعمولاً بر اساس قدرت پردازشی و پایداری

جمع‌بندی

راستش رو بخوای، بعد از سال‌ها کار با انواع میزبان‌ها و پروژه‌های دانلودی، یه چیزو خوب یاد گرفتم: بیشتر دردسرها از جایی شروع می‌شن که هنوز به خرید هاست دانلود جدا فکر نکردیم. یادمه یه زمانی سایت من یه افزونه رایگان منتشر کرده بود و تعداد دانلودها ناگهان زیاد شد. همون موقع کاربرا شروع کردن پیام دادن که “سایت باز نمی‌شه” یا “سرعتش افت کرده”.

فقط وقتی فایل‌های دانلودی رو بردم روی یه هاست دانلود مجزا، اوضاع آروم شد. سایت نفس کشید، سرعت برگشت، و من دیگه نگران افزایش ترافیک ناگهانی نبودم.

اگه تو هم قراره فایل‌های زیاد یا سنگین برای دانلود بذاری، پیشنهاد من اینه از همون اول یه زیرساخت جدا برای دانلود در نظر بگیر. باور کن، جلوی کلی دردسر آینده رو می‌گیره.
تو تا حالا تجربه مشابهی داشتی؟

@m!n

امین هستم؛ مفاهیم فنی هاستینگ تا بهینه‌سازی سرعت رو ساده و عملی توضیح می‌دم. اینجا می‌نویسم تا با کمترین اصطلاحات پیچیده، بیشترین نتیجه رو…

مشاهده آخرین نوشته → تعداد مطالب: 19